{{tag>compiz_fusion}}


====== Compiz Fusion : Plugins additionnels======

<note important>Cette page est une sous-partie de la page [[:compiz_fusion|Compiz-Fusion (gestionnaire de bureau en 3D)]].</note> 

 Cette page recense les plugins qu'il est possible d'installer en plus de ceux déjà présents
 dans Compiz-Fusion. Si certaines personnes ont des problèmes pour compiler ou installer les plugins additionnels, vous trouverez de l'aide sur cette page.



===== Plugins additionnels présents dans les dépôts=====

==== compiz-fusion-plugins-extra ====

{{cap1.png?200}} 

[[:tutoriel:comment_installer_un_paquet|Installez le paquet]] [[apt://compiz-fusion-plugins-extra|compiz-fusion-plugins-extra]] (lié au paquet [[apt://compiz|compiz]] sur Intrepid).
Il vous permettra par exemple d'obtenir un (**cylindre**) ou une (**sphère**).

====compiz-fusion-plugins-unsupported  (Neige,Cube Atlantis,Rouages dans le cube etc...) ====
{{cap.png?200}} 
[[:tutoriel:comment_installer_un_paquet|Installez le paquet]] [[apt://compiz-fusion-plugins-unsupported|compiz-fusion-plugins-unsupported]].
<note important>Attention, ces effets risquent de rendre le système instable sur certaines machines.</note> 

====Installation des bibliothèques pour la compilation des plugins additionnels==== 

Pour (**Ubuntu 8.04 LTS**) ,(**Hardy Heron**),(**Kubuntu**) indiquer dans un terminal :


<code> sudo apt-get install compizconfig-settings-manager</code>  

<code> sudo apt-get install compiz-fusion-bcop git-core compiz-dev build-essential libxcomposite-dev libpng12-dev libsm-dev libxrandr-dev libxdamage-dev libxinerama-dev libstartup-notification0-dev libgconf2-dev libgl1-mesa-dev libglu1-mesa-dev libmetacity-dev libtool </code>

<code> sudo apt-get install compiz-dev build-essential libxcomposite-dev libpng12-dev libsm-dev libxrandr-dev libxdamage-dev libxinerama-dev libstartup-notification0-dev libgconf2-dev libgl1-mesa-dev libglu1-mesa-dev libmetacity-dev librsvg2-dev libdbus-1-dev libdbus-glib-1-dev libgnome-desktop-dev libgnome-window-settings-dev gitweb curl autoconf automake automake1.9 libtool intltool libxslt1-dev xsltproc emerald x11proto-scrnsaver-dev libxss-dev</code>

====Installation et compilation des plugins additionnels====

<note important>Attention, certains plugins risquent de rendre compiz-fusion instable.</note>  

====Plugins additionnels Screensaver====

{{cap11.png?200}} 

(**Screensaver**) est un écran de veille  permettant d'avoir le cube de compiz-fusion en rotation.

 Pour (**Installation**) du (**Plugins**) indiquer dans un terminal :

<code>
mkdir -p  ~/.compizplugins/
cd .compizplugins                     (ou plutôt : cd ~/.compizplugins )

git clone git://anongit.compiz.org/users/pafy/screensaver

cd ~/.compizplugins/screensaver
make clean
make
make install
</code>
Vidéo de démonstration ici:[[http://www.youtube.com/watch?v=vkki_lsXDNU]]

====Plugins additionnels Atlantis2====

{{cap12.png?200}} {{cap3.png?200}} 

(**Atlantis2**) est un aquarium permettant d'avoir certains animaux marins à l'intérieur du cube 

 Pour (**Installation**) du (**Plugins**) indiquer dans un terminal :

<code>
mkdir -p  ~/.compizplugins/
cd .compizplugins

git clone git://anongit.compiz-fusion.org/users/metastability/atlantis2

cd ~/.compizplugins/atlantis2
make clean
make
make install
</code>
Vidéo de démonstration ici:[[http://www.youtube.com/watch?v=zMXAKbU2Kg0]]

====Plugins additionnels Rubik's cube====

{{cap13.png?200}} 

(**Rubik's cube**) est un plugins permettant de transformez le cube de compiz-fusion en rubik's Cube

 Pour (**Installation**) du (**Plugins**) indiquer dans un terminal :

<code>
mkdir -p  ~/.compizplugins/
cd .compizplugins

git clone git://anongit.compiz.org/users/metastability/rubik

cd ~/.compizplugins/rubik
make clean
make
make install
</code>
Vidéo de démonstration ici:[[http://www.youtube.com/watch?v=6OXOVxDxXcY]]

====Plugins additionnels Freewins====

{{cap6.png?200}} {{cap7.png?200}} {{cap8.png?200}}  

(**Freewins**) est un plugins permettant d'avoir l'effet Aero Glass de windows vista.

 Pour (**Installation**) du (**Plugins**) indiquer dans un terminal :

<code>
mkdir -p  ~/.compizplugins/
cd .compizplugins

git clone git://anongit.compiz.org/users/warlock/freewins

cd ~/.compizplugins/freewins
make clean
make
make install
</code>

====Plugins additionnels Wallpaper====

{{cap9.png?200}} {{cap10.png?200}}

(**Wallpaper**) est un plugins permettant d'avoir 4 fond d'écrans different sur le cube. 

 Pour (**Installation**) du (**Plugins**) indiquer dans un terminal :

<code>
mkdir -p  ~/.compizplugins/
cd .compizplugins

git clone git://anongit.compiz.org/compiz/plugins/wallpaper

cd ~/.compizplugins/wallpaper
make clean
make
make install
</code>
Pour toutes question[[http://forum.ubuntu-fr.org/viewtopic.php?id=219217]]

====Plugins additionnels Stackswitch====

(**Stackswitch**) est un plugins permettant de basculer entre les applications (alt+tab). 

 Pour (**Installation**) du (**Plugins**) indiquer dans un terminal :

<code>
mkdir -p  ~/.compizplugins/
cd .compizplugins

git clone git://anongit.compiz.org/fusion/plugins/stackswitch

cd ~/.compizplugins/stackswitch
make clean
make
make install
</code>
Vidéo de démonstration ici: http://www.youtube.com/watch?v=dJbgjBX8DaI

====Script Compiz-fusion+Tous les plugins additionnels ====

Pour (**Ubuntu 8.04 LTS**) ,(**Hardy Heron**),(**Kubuntu**)

Script réalisé par (**Smo**) et repris par (**Paratox**)

<code>
sudo apt-get install compizconfig-settings-manager compiz-fusion-bcop git-core compiz-dev build-essential libxcomposite-dev libpng12-dev libsm-dev libxrandr-dev libxdamage-dev libxinerama-dev libstartup-notification0-dev libgconf2-dev libgl1-mesa-dev libglu1-mesa-dev libmetacity-dev libtool compiz-dev build-essential libxcomposite-dev libpng12-dev libsm-dev libxrandr-dev libxdamage-dev libxinerama-dev libstartup-notification0-dev libgconf2-dev libgl1-mesa-dev libglu1-mesa-dev libmetacity-dev librsvg2-dev libdbus-1-dev libdbus-glib-1-dev libgnome-desktop-dev libgnome-window-settings-dev gitweb curl autoconf automake automake1.9 libtool intltool libxslt1-dev xsltproc emerald x11proto-scrnsaver-dev libxss-dev
</code>

<code>
mkdir -p  ~/.compizplugins/
cd .compizplugins

git clone git://anongit.compiz-fusion.org/fusion/plugins/wallpaper
git clone git://anongit.compiz-fusion.org/users/pafy/screensaver
git clone git://anongit.compiz-fusion.org/users/metastability/atlantis2
git clone git://anongit.compiz-fusion.org/users/wodor/anaglyph
git clone git://anongit.compiz.org/users/metastability/rubik
git clone git://anongit.compiz.org/fusion/plugins/animationaddon
git clone git://anongit.compiz.org/users/edgurgel/toggle-decoration
git clone git://anongit.compiz.org/fusion/plugins/cubemodel
git clone git://anongit.compiz.org/users/warlock/freewins
cd ~/.compizplugins/wallpaper
make clean
make
make install
cd ~/.compizplugins/screensaver
make clean
make
make install
cd ~/.compizplugins/atlantis2
make clean
make
make install
cd ~/.compizplugins/anaglyph
make clean
make
make install
cd ~/.compizplugins/rubik
make clean
make
make install
cd ~/.compizplugins/animationaddon
make clean
make
make install
cd ~/.compizplugins/toggle-decoration
make clean
make
make install
cd ~/.compizplugins/cubemodel 
make clean
make
make install
cd ~/.compizplugins/freewins
make clean
make
make install
</code>

  - Copiez ce texte dans un fichier vierge.Renommez ce fichier avec l'extension (**.sh**)
  - Ensuite, faites un clic droit, allez dans (**propriétés**)
  - Dans l'onglet permission, cochez la case (**autoriser**) a (**exécuter**) comme un (**programme**)
  - Il ne vous reste plus qu'a (**double cliquer**) sur le fichier et à le lancer dans un(**terminal**)

====Plugins additionnels supplémentaires====

<note tip>Cette page [[http://cgit.compiz-fusion.org/]] est une liste des anciens et des nouveaux plugins qu'il est possible d'installer sur compiz-fusion avec la possibilité de récupérer le fichier (**ssh**) pour recompiler les plugins additionnels </note>
<note warning>(**Attention**) certains (**Plugins**) ne sont pas stables, assurez-vous d'avoir la (**dernière version**) de (**compiz-fusion**) (**installée**). </note>
{{cap4.png?200}} {{cap5.png?200}}

====Installation des Plugins additionnels supplémentaires====

  - Consultez la page [[http://cgit.compiz-fusion.org/]].
  - Ensuite, faites un (**clic**) sur les (**plugins additionnels**) que vous avez (**choisi**);
  - Dans (**l'onglet**) (**clone**),Copiez (**cette ligne**): 


<code>
git://anongit.compiz.org/fusion/plugins/cubemodel
</code>

  - Et (**remplacez**) cette ligne par (**celle-ci**):

<code>
git clone git://anongit.compiz.org/fusion/plugins/cubemodel
</code>

  - Ce qui nous (**donne**) pour l'(**installation**):

<code>
mkdir -p  ~/.compizplugins/
cd .compizplugins

git clone git://anongit.compiz.org/fusion/plugins/cubemodel

cd ~/.compizplugins/cubemodel 
make clean
make
make install
</code>

  - Copiez ce texte dans un fichier vierge. Renommez ce fichier avec l'extension (**.sh**)
  - Ensuite, faites un clic droit, allez dans (**propriétés**)
  - Dans l'onglet permissions, cochez la case (**autoriser**) à (**exécuter**) comme un (**programme**)
  - Il ne vous reste plus qu'a (**double-cliquer**) sur le fichier et à le lancer dans un (**terminal**)



































 




 













